ICMP remote shell

Prototype of steganography remote shell using ICMP protocol for data hiding.

To install packet use pip:

pip install icmp_remote_shell

Packet provides some common functions can be used in your ICMP steganography projects:

  • checksum - calculates packet checksum
  • send_one_ping - sends one ICMP packet
  • send_one - as previous but more convenient
  • start_sniffing - starts ICMP packets sniffer

Packet also provides to commandline utils for creating remote shell.

icmp-remote-shell-client - ICMP remote shell client

Usage:

icmp-remote-shell-client host_out host_in \[ping_delay\] \[log_file\]

where:

  • host_out - The interface to send requests
  • host_in - The interface to listen replies
  • ping_delay - Delay between answer pings in seconds, default is 1
  • log_file - File to log server answers, default is /var/log/icmp_covert.log

icmp-remote-shell-server - ICMP remote shell server

Usage:

icmp-remote-shell-server host \[ping_delay\]

where:

  • host - The interface to listen request
  • ping_delay - Delay between answer pings in seconds, default is 1

Note: commands should run under user with privileges to send ICMP messages only
